{"id":369841,"date":"2025-09-29T19:32:28","date_gmt":"2025-09-29T18:32:28","guid":{"rendered":"https:\/\/www.yvesbeck.wine\/?p=369841"},"modified":"2025-09-29T19:32:28","modified_gmt":"2025-09-29T18:32:28","slug":"mouton-rothschild-over-the-decades","status":"publish","type":"post","link":"https:\/\/www.yvesbeck.wine\/en\/mouton-rothschild-over-the-decades\/","title":{"rendered":"Mouton Rothschild over the decades"},"content":{"rendered":"<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><strong>Mouton Rothschild between 1918 and 2018<\/strong><\/p>\n<h4 style=\"text-align: justify;\"><strong>A tasting full of surprises<\/strong><\/h4>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">When I received the list of wines for the tasting, somewhere underground in Zug, it was clear that the 2018 and 1982 vintages were the two blue chips of the tasting. The other wines were 1994, 1987, 1976, 1960, 1952 and 1918.<\/p>\n<h4 style=\"text-align: justify;\"><strong>No one would bet a penny on a wine from 1960.<\/strong><\/h4>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">We all know that, really. Wine is tasted and then discussed. Often, however, the opposite is true. The 1960 vintage did have one advantage, though. Since virtually no one expected anything from it, it had a not inconsiderable opportunity to surprise!<\/p>\n<h4 style=\"text-align: justify;\"><strong>Brief summary<\/strong><\/h4>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">The <b>1918 <\/b>made a serene and confident impression, while the <b>1952<\/b> was somewhat tired but honourable. The <b>1960<\/b> reminded us that one should first taste a wine and then discuss it, while the <b>1976<\/b> surprised everyone with its form, with tannins that were not the finest but provided a solid backbone.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">The <b>1987<\/b> enjoyed the Swiss bonus (label by <a href=\"https:\/\/de.wikipedia.org\/wiki\/Hans_Erni\">Hans Erni<\/a>) and reminded us once again that it was time to drink it, but it has been doing so for twenty years! The <b>1982<\/b> has taken on its role as a benchmark with composure, and the <b>2018<\/b> has allowed itself to challenge it by positioning itself on an equal footing without any complexes!<\/p>\n<hr \/>\n<h4 style=\"text-align: center;\"><strong>Tasting notes by Yves Beck<\/strong><\/h4>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-369747 aligncenter\" src=\"https:\/\/www.yvesbeck.wine\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/09\/Mouton-1918-yvesbeck.wine_-1200x1037.jpg\" alt=\"Mouton Rothschild 1918 - yvesbeck.wine\" width=\"379\" height=\"328\" \/><\/p>\n<h4><strong>Ch\u00e2teau Mouton Rothschild 1918<\/strong><\/h4>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">The bouquet reveals notes of caramel, vetiver and iodine, clearly dominated by tertiary aromas. After aeration, notes of red berries even emerge. The wine shows no signs of oxidation, at most a little fatigue, which is perfectly acceptable for a 107-year-old wine! On the palate, the wine thrives on its acidity, which sets the tone. This is actually the only component that is really noticeable besides an astonishing harmony! This last point is particularly commendable; it doesn&#8217;t have much, but it can do a lot!<\/p>\n<hr \/>\n<h4><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-369741 aligncenter\" src=\"https:\/\/www.yvesbeck.wine\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/09\/Mouton-Rothschild-1952-yvesbeck.wine_-1200x960.png\" alt=\"Mouton Rothschild 1952 - yvesbeck.wine\" width=\"513\" height=\"410\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.yvesbeck.wine\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/09\/Mouton-Rothschild-1952-yvesbeck.wine_-1200x960.png 1200w, https:\/\/www.yvesbeck.wine\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/09\/Mouton-Rothschild-1952-yvesbeck.wine_-800x640.png 800w, https:\/\/www.yvesbeck.wine\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/09\/Mouton-Rothschild-1952-yvesbeck.wine_-768x615.png 768w, https:\/\/www.yvesbeck.wine\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/09\/Mouton-Rothschild-1952-yvesbeck.wine_-1080x864.png 1080w, https:\/\/www.yvesbeck.wine\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/09\/Mouton-Rothschild-1952-yvesbeck.wine_-300x240.png 300w, https:\/\/www.yvesbeck.wine\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/09\/Mouton-Rothschild-1952-yvesbeck.wine_-600x480.png 600w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 513px) 100vw, 513px\" \/><\/h4>\n<h4><strong>Ch\u00e2teau Mouton Rothschild 1952<\/strong><\/h4>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Quite an intense bouquet with notes of green curry and malt, followed by Szechuan pepper. The bouquet resembles a swan song, but one cannot shake the feeling that it could sing for even longer! On the palate, the wine captivates with its slender character and its ability to combine temperament, elegance and austerity. All this confirms its current form and its quite long finish, but it has nevertheless passed its zenith.<\/p>\n<hr \/>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-369753 aligncenter\" src=\"https:\/\/www.yvesbeck.wine\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/09\/Mouton-1960-yvesbeck.wine_-1200x1060.jpg\" alt=\"Mouton Rothschild 1960 - yvesbeck.wine\" width=\"527\" height=\"466\" \/><\/p>\n<h4><b>Ch\u00e2teau Mouton Rothschild 1960<\/b><\/h4>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">It is not often that one encounters a 1960 Mouton (or other wines), and some might say that is just as well&#8230; Irony aside, it should be said that the wine performs very well! It serves as a reminder that one should taste a wine first and then debate it&#8230; not the other way around. A lean, juicy wine that is on the decline, but that doesn&#8217;t prevent it from being enjoyable.<\/p>\n<hr \/>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\" wp-image-369756 aligncenter\" src=\"https:\/\/www.yvesbeck.wine\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/09\/Mouton-Rothschild-1976-yvesbeck.wine_-1200x971.jpg\" alt=\"Mouton Rothschild 1976 - yvesbeck.wine\" width=\"489\" height=\"395\" \/><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h4><strong>Ch\u00e2teau Mouton Rothschild 1976<\/strong><\/h4>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Nuances of herbs and liquorice with a hint of pumpernickel and malt. On the palate, the wine reveals a fleshy side and quite pronounced tannins, and it is precisely here that this 1976 Mouton surprises with a mouth-watering acidity. This makes the wine harmonious and ready to drink. A lovely surprise! Now until 2036.<\/p>\n<hr \/>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-369759 aligncenter\" src=\"https:\/\/www.yvesbeck.wine\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/09\/Mouton-Rothschild-1982-yvesbeck.wine_-1200x932.jpg\" alt=\"Mouton Rothschild 1982 - yvesbeck.wine\" width=\"538\" height=\"418\" \/><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h4><strong>Ch\u00e2teau Mouton Rothschild 1982<\/strong><\/h4>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">85% Cabernet Sauvignon, 8% Cabernet Franc, 7% Merlot<br \/>\nThe 1982 vintage is legendary and the consistency of this wine over the years is impressive! Noble wood notes, cedar wood and black berries are equally present. The wine impresses with its freshness, acidity and long finish. A wine that seems a little closed to me, but has breathtaking energy. With air, it gains definition and detail. A Mouton 1982 that perfectly fulfils its role as a benchmark! Now until 2075.<\/p>\n<hr \/>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\" wp-image-369762 aligncenter\" src=\"https:\/\/www.yvesbeck.wine\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/09\/Mouton-Rothschild-1987-yvesbeck.wine_-1200x1076.jpg\" alt=\"Mouton Rothschild 1987 - yvesbeck.wine\" width=\"536\" height=\"481\" \/><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h4><strong>Ch\u00e2teau Mouton Rothschild 1987<\/strong><\/h4>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">85% Cabernet Sauvignon, 8% Merlot, 7% Cabernet Franc<br \/>\nNuances of curry, roasted paprika and mocha, followed by a hint of cassis in this bouquet; it fluctuates between tiredness and endurance! The wine surprises with tannins that are still present, accompanied by the acidity structure. It has a little less body than before, but it still has power and length. Just as I was about to write that it was on the decline, this \u201cfellow\u201d actually found new youth, or rather new life, in the carafe! So once again I can write that it&#8217;s time to drink it&#8230; But I&#8217;ve been doing that for 20 years&#8230; and I just can&#8217;t get enough of it! Drink up<\/p>\n<hr \/>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\" wp-image-369766 aligncenter\" src=\"https:\/\/www.yvesbeck.wine\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/09\/Mouton-Rothschild-1994-yvesbeck.wine_-1200x964.jpg\" alt=\"Mouton Rothschild 1994 - yvesbeck.wine\" width=\"516\" height=\"415\" \/><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h4><strong>Ch\u00e2teau Mouton Rothschild 1994<\/strong><\/h4>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">80% Cabernet Sauvignon, 10% Merlot, 8% Cabernet Franc, 2% Petit Verdot<br \/>\nThe characteristics of the Mouton family are unmistakable on both the nose and palate. Notes of graphite and cedar, complemented by a hint of mint and hops, precede a lovely attack. The tannin structure provides power. It is not particularly fine, but strong and, together with the acidity structure, promises exceptional potential. This is a wine that continues to develop and deserves our attention, as it is largely underrated. Although it is not particularly expressive today, this is only a temporary state. It has all the components to be one of the great Moutons! As we know, hope dies last. Now until 2045.<\/p>\n<hr \/>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\" wp-image-369770 aligncenter\" src=\"https:\/\/www.yvesbeck.wine\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/09\/Mouton-Rothschild-2018-yvesbeck.wine_-1200x1101.jpg\" alt=\"Mouton Rothschild 2018 - yvesbeck.wine\" width=\"512\" height=\"470\" \/><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h4><strong>Ch\u00e2teau Mouton Rothschild 2018<\/strong><\/h4>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">86% Cabernet Sauvignon, 12% Merlot, 2% Cabernet Franc<br \/>\nThe depth of the bouquet is immediately apparent! The wood tones are perfectly integrated, black berries accompanied by cocoa beans and graphite dominate, and the wine seems to me to have entered a phase of extraordinary serenity! The delicate attack typical of Mouton is replaced by compact, elegant, velvety tannins that provide power and tartness. The latter guarantees not only the palate aroma but also the lingering finish. A remarkable wine that deserves our patience!
